SISterhood FUNDRAISING

SISterhodd hosts fundraising events each year which generate revenue to support our shul. Most of our fundraising income comes from the High Holiday Booklet and our annual Major Fundraising Event. The High Holiday Booklet is a pamphlet in which you may purchase greetings, blessings, and memorials for your family members. It is a lovely and generous way to honor your loved ones at the Jewish New Year. The annual Major Fundraising Event is our biggest fundraiser of the year. It has evolved over the years and has taken many forms. Whether it is a Casino Night, Comedy Club, Mystery Night, Theater Night or Second Chance Prom, the Major Fundraising Event has become a very special evening including a Silent Auction and Raffle. SISterhood is very proud of the fact that the monies raised from our fundraising efforts go back to our synagogue in meaningful and productive ways.

SISterhood generously gives back by:

• Supplying backpacks to Religious School students
• Providing Holiday treats to Religious School students
• Supporting special Religious School programs for Hanukkah and Passover
• Underwriting the costs of the Religious School Computer Lab
• Purchasing a CD Recorder and Duplicator for the Religious School
• Giving gifts to our Preschool graduates and Kindergarten graduates
• Presenting Siyyum gifts to students in grades 1st-5th
• Offering Bar/Bat Mitzvah, Confirmation, and Graduation gifts to our students
• Supporting our Young Professionals Series
• Contributing to the Tiny Treasures Program
• Funding the Shabbat Transliteration mailing
• Providing a defibrillator for our shul congregation
• Acquiring a telephone messaging system for the synagogue
• Purchasing High Holiday gifts for our Kley Kodesh
• Offering shiva meals and Shabbat dinners to our congregants
• Contributing to the Vision 2000 and Beyond Campaign
